package thahn.java.agui.ide.eclipse.project; import static org.eclipse.ui.ISharedImages.IMG_DEC_FIELD_ERROR; import static org.eclipse.ui.ISharedImages.IMG_DEC_FIELD_WARNING; import static org.eclipse.ui.ISharedImages.IMG_OBJS_ERROR_TSK; import static org.eclipse.ui.ISharedImages.IMG_OBJS_WARN_TSK; import org.eclipse.jface.resource.CompositeImageDescriptor; import org.eclipse.jface.resource.ImageDescriptor; import org.eclipse.jface.viewers.DecorationOverlayIcon; import org.eclipse.swt.graphics.Image; import org.eclipse.swt.graphics.ImageData; import org.eclipse.swt.graphics.Point; import org.eclipse.ui.ISharedImages; import org.eclipse.ui.PlatformUI; /** * ImageDescriptor that adds a error marker. * Based on {@link DecorationOverlayIcon} only available in Eclipse 3.3 */ public class ErrorImageComposite extends CompositeImageDescriptor { private Image mBaseImage; private ImageDescriptor mErrorImageDescriptor; private Point mSize; /** * Creates a new {@link ErrorImageComposite} * * @param baseImage the base image to overlay an icon on top of */ public ErrorImageComposite(Image baseImage) { this(baseImage, false); } /** * Creates a new {@link ErrorImageComposite} * * @param baseImage the base image to overlay an icon on top of * @param warning if true, add a warning icon, otherwise an error icon */ public ErrorImageComposite(Image baseImage, boolean warning) { mBaseImage = baseImage; ISharedImages sharedImages = PlatformUI.getWorkbench().getSharedImages(); mErrorImageDescriptor = sharedImages.getImageDescriptor( warning ? IMG_DEC_FIELD_WARNING : IMG_DEC_FIELD_ERROR); if (mErrorImageDescriptor == null) { mErrorImageDescriptor = sharedImages.getImageDescriptor( warning ? IMG_OBJS_WARN_TSK : IMG_OBJS_ERROR_TSK); } mSize = new Point(baseImage.getBounds().width, baseImage.getBounds().height); } @Override protected void drawCompositeImage(int width, int height) { ImageData baseData = mBaseImage.getImageData(); drawImage(baseData, 0, 0); ImageData overlayData = mErrorImageDescriptor.getImageData(); if (overlayData.width == baseData.width && overlayData.height == baseData.height) { overlayData = overlayData.scaledTo(14, 14); drawImage(overlayData, -3, mSize.y - overlayData.height + 3); } else { drawImage(overlayData, 0, mSize.y - overlayData.height); } } @Override protected Point getSize() { return mSize; } }
